phase ranging sensor  PHR Series

The new product released this time isLong-range phase sensor (Laser distance sensor), There are currently two transmission distances to choose from, namely 80m/120 m.

Using the phase ranging sensor, the filtering parameters, position information 1, position information 2, etc. can be queried by the upper computer. The software can also clearly draw the distance curve of position 1 and position 2.

The real-time distance of the three curves and the interval range of the deviation value can be visually observed through the software:The repetition accuracy of the original data is ± 1mm.,The repetition accuracy of the Kalman filter data is ± 0.5mm.,The repeatability of complementary filtering is ± 0.1mmUsers can choose which type of data to determine the distance between the device and the object according to their needs.

Application Scenarios

  • Locate moving automation components

  • Moving axis and lifting axis of stacker equipment

  • Gantry Suspension Bridge and Sled

  • Electroplating equipment

  • Elevator, crane, crane and other mobile units

Product Highlights

  • Up to 3KHz update rate (currently the fastest on the market)

  • High precision repetition accuracy of 1 mm/s

  • Supports up to 12 m/s movement rate measurement

  • High reliability, even in the farthest range (200 meters), still maintain the accuracy of ± 2mm

  • With IP65 waterproof rating, SSI,CANOpen and Ethernet interface, can adapt to more use scenarios

  • Quick and intuitive viewing of distance values and configuration parameters with an operable display

  • Humanized design, hard metal aluminum shell supporting fixed bracket makes installation and replacement of equipment easier
